FAQs for finding caregivers in Seattle, WA
What caregiver services can I find near me in Seattle, WA?
Most private senior caregiver services in Seattle, WA will offer companionship, safety supervision, and assistance with daily activities in the comfort of the person's home. Caregivers can help seniors to move safely around their home, provide social and emotional support, assist with different degrees of personal care (bathing, dressing, or feeding), and help with meal preparations or light housekeeping. They can also help your loved one with medication reminders, and some can even drive them to any errand or doctor appointments around Seattle.
How much does it cost to hire a caregiver in Seattle, WA in 2024?
The average rate for hiring a caregiver in Seattle, WA on Care.com as of October, 2024 is $25.74 per hour. This cost may fluctuate depending on the type of assistance needed by your senior loved one and the caregiver's experience and certifications.

Are private caregivers near me in Seattle, WA background checked?
Yes, caregivers near you in Seattle, WA on Care.com are asked to complete an annual background check called a CareCheck. Senior caregivers who complete this background check will have a badge on their profile displaying the date it was run. While CareCheck is a good start, we strongly recommend that you follow some additional steps for hiring a caregiver for seniors safely, which include interviewing candidates, checking references, and running your own background check.
